My Buying Guides on Major Grey’s Mango Chutney
What I Look for in Major Grey’s Mango Chutney
When I shop for Major Grey’s Mango Chutney, I focus on the balance of sweet, tangy, and mildly spiced flavors. I prefer a chutney that tastes rich and fruity without being overly sugary. For me, the best versions have a smooth texture with visible mango pieces and a pleasant hint of vinegar and spices.
Checking the Ingredient List
I always read the ingredient label first. I look for real mango as the main ingredient, along with natural spices, vinegar, and a short list of preservatives. If I see too many artificial additives or excessive corn syrup, I usually skip it. A cleaner ingredient list gives me more confidence in the quality.
Flavor Profile I Prefer
Major Grey’s Mango Chutney should have a classic sweet-and-savory taste. I enjoy one that is not too hot, since this style is usually meant to be mild and versatile. I like a chutney that works well with cheese, sandwiches, curries, grilled meats, and even as a glaze.
Packaging and Jar Quality
I pay attention to the jar or packaging because it affects freshness and storage. I prefer a tightly sealed glass jar since it helps preserve flavor better and is easier for me to store in the pantry. A clear jar also lets me check the color and texture before buying.
Size and Value for Money
I think about how often I use chutney before choosing a size. If I use it regularly, I go for a larger jar because it usually offers better value. If I’m trying a new brand, I start with a smaller jar so I can test the taste before committing to a bigger purchase.
Brand Reputation
I trust brands that are known for consistent quality and traditional chutney recipes. When I see positive reviews about flavor, texture, and freshness, I feel more comfortable buying. For me, a well-reviewed brand often means fewer surprises.
How I Use It at Home
I like choosing a chutney that is versatile enough for different meals. I use Major Grey’s Mango Chutney with crackers and cheese, in wraps, alongside roasted meats, or mixed into marinades. Because of that, I prefer a chutney that tastes balanced and not too overpowering.
Storage and Shelf Life
I always check the expiration date before buying. I also make sure the jar can be stored easily after opening. A chutney with a good shelf life gives me peace of mind, especially if I don’t plan to use it every day.
